Another promising contender is Polkadot (DOT), aiming to democratize interoperability across the blockchain universe. DOT's parachains and relay chain model seeks to create a network where different blockchains can communicate seamlessly without compromising on security or decentralization. This could potentially open up new frontiers for DeFi (Decentralized Finance) applications, enabling users to access a broader range of financial services in one place. The future is looking bright for DOT as it positions itself at the heart of an emerging ecosystem that seeks to unite blockchain networks into a single, secure and scalable platform.
